The Australian Museum is pleased to announce the Lizard Island Fellowships
Program for 2011. These fellowships support field-intensive research at the
Museum's Lizard Island Research Station on the northern Great Barrier Reef.
The Lizard Island Fellowships Program has operated since 1984, providing
$586,000 to support the work of 42 PhD students and 8 postdoctoral
researchers. This year, five fellowships are offered.
Two fellowships for PhD students, AU$8,000 per year for up to three years.
1) Lizard Island Doctoral Fellowship - for PhD students. Funding provided by
the Lizard Island Reef Research Foundation members.
2) Ian Potter Doctoral Fellowship at Lizard Island - for PhD students.
Funding provided by the Ian Potter Foundation.
Preliminary applications for these fellowships close on 20 August 2010.
Three fellowships for early-career postdoctoral researchers, AU$11,000 to be
spent in one year.
3) Isobel Bennett Marine Biology Fellowship - for recent PhDs. Funding
provided by the Hermon Slade Raiatea Foundation.
4) John and Laurine Proud Fellowship - for recent PhDs. Funding provided by
the John and Laurine Proud Estate Trust.
5) Yulgilbar Foundation Fellowship - for recent PhDs. Funding provided by
the Yulgilbar Foundation.
Applications for these fellowships close on 30 September 2010.
